Transaction a18d718a84160a57d88a49e5be52773dfa29b701f0593cc0807d10132610328c
1 Input
2 Outputs
- a18d718a84160a57d88a49e5be52773dfa29b701f0593cc0807d10132610328c:0
- a18d718a84160a57d88a49e5be52773dfa29b701f0593cc0807d10132610328c:1
value 356005115
address 3HRkfPuZn2PkupKx7moSdRKy4Czqg5qzgE
value 22817548573
address 1BwKwL3XgBzqow5iheVoozP6VkcyoeF3FQ